Chicagoland's Best Indoor Play Places to Beat Cabin Fever

As the holidays have come to a close, everyone knows the all to familiar feeling of cabin fever, especially those with children. Chicagoland offers some of the best indoor play areas for families on all sorts of budgets. PLACES:

Make-A-Messterpiece: Glenview, IL good for ages 0-10ish Unique concept that fosters childrens' natural creativity and curiosity and love of getting messy, with no cleanup for moms $10 entrance fee includes two small play areas (one for babies) and large art studio with tables and easels $5 for each add-on station: creative kitchen, bubbleology, drum roll (Blue Man type experience for kids - very cool), crafts, and experiements. All access pass to cover all sections sometimes offered at a good savings; punch cards offered at substantial savings. Very nice lounge area for parents with free wi fi, coffee for sale, and closed circuit tvs so they can watch their children. One big space so you can see everything and keep track of your children. Located in The Glen, so many restaurants and shops within walking distance

Water Works Indoor Park: Schaumburg, IL Part of the Schaumburg Park District 3 slides, 1 drop slide, zero depth entry, water playground, rapid water channel Learned about this from one of our members Fun, water-park type atmosphere without the cost. Easy to keep your eyes on the kids. $5-$9

Fantasy Kingdom: Chicago, IL Good for kids 6 & under Separate play area for the wee ones Fun medieval theme for imaginative play Dress-up, fire station, grocery, jail, castle, Limited food items available for purchase, but parents can bring food, $12 per child; parents free; membership packages are available at a savings.

La Grange Indoor Playground: La Grange, IL Part of the LaGrange Park District Another hidden gem we learned about from our members large indoor playgound, slides, monkey bars, brindges, climbing, padded floor Kids love playgrounds - here's a low-cost way to enjoy one when the weather doesn't cooperate. $3 per child, parents free . Pump It Up: Chicago, Glenview, Vernon Hills, Crystal Lake, Schaumburg, Lisle, Elmhurst, Orland Park Perfect for getting rid of excess energy Locations throughout the Chicago area Open jump times and age ranges vary; special jumps offered for holidays, school breaks, etc.; kidwinks' Events Calendar lists them all Many similar businesses can also be found on our site

Safari Land Indoor Amusement Park: Villa Park, IL Lion's den soft play area for little ones (under 52") with tubes, tunnels, slides ($4.00 for this section only) 12 lane bowling alley with cosmic bowling; bowling specials on certain weekdays Rides: roller coaster, bumper cars, kiddie go carts, tilt-a-whirl, Merry-go-round, flight simulator. Video games On site restaurant. • Great place for families with children of varying age ranges (toddlers - teens). • Wrist bands available on weekdays for good savings and unlimited rides on certain attractions ($15).
